Output d6a884976a93993603fa08dc3f0f2a26c79b00c4fa2d0c25b44ba36c581f0fbc:1

value
2011500
script pubkey
OP_0 OP_PUSHBYTES_20 0baf3a8024d36bef846b11cefe2dbb7ebbb1324a
address
bc1qpwhn4qpy6d47lprtz880utdm06amzvj2yh8mmy
transaction
d6a884976a93993603fa08dc3f0f2a26c79b00c4fa2d0c25b44ba36c581f0fbc
confirmations
115263
spent
true